Fly ash and Blast Furnace Slag for Cement Manufacturing

such as Fly Ash (FA) from coal power plants and Granulated Blast Furnace Slag (GBFS) from the iron and steel sector. These materials are currently used as cement or concrete additions in the UK, thereby reducing CO2 emissions of the cement and concrete sector. The Difference in Slag Cement and Fly Ash - Slag Cement …

Slag cement (Ground Granulated Blast Furnace Slag) and fly ash (Coal Combustion Product) are the most commonly used supplementary cementitious materials in construction today. While they are commonly used and similar in many ways, these materials produce different effects on concrete performance and this document will explore those differences.

Fly Ash - Cement industry news from Global Cement

Pakistan: The upcoming Diamer Basha Dam and 21MW Tangir Hydropower Project will use concrete made from Ordinary Portland Cement mixed with fly ash and other additives. The Frontier Works Organisation said, “This reduces thermal loads on the dam and reduces chances of thermal cracking,” according to China Daily News.

New Construction Materials for Modern Projects

Ternary blended cements containing the combination of fly ash–slag, fly ash–silica fume or slag–silica fume are commonly used for concrete in many parts of the world. The European Standard EN 197 for cement lists 27 different combinations for cement. Usually mineral admixture used may present a complimentary effect on cement hydration.

Use of Steel Slag in Subgrade Applications

EAF(L) slag and mixtures of steel slag and Class-C fly ash can be used in the design of various types of geotechnical projects, such as small roads and highway embankments. Experimental Study on the Utilization of Fine Steel Slag ...

The three major steel manufacturing factories in Jordan dump their byproduct, steel slag, randomly in open areas, which causes many environmental hazardous problems. This study intended to explore the effectiveness of using fine steel slag aggregate (FSSA) in improving the geotechnical properties of high plastic subgrade soil.
